How Apartment Water Extraction Actually Works

Our process for Apartment Water Extraction is designed to be as efficient and effective as possible, with a focus on reducing disruption to your daily routine. We’ll start by ass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to get your property back to normal. Our team will use specialized equipment to extract the water, and then dry out the affected area using advanced drying techniques.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your apartment back to normal. This includes identifying the source of the leak, evaluating the extent of the damage, and determining the best course of action to take.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use specialized equipment to extract the water from your apartment,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extraction equipment.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to reduce disruption to your daily routine.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use advanced drying techniques to dry out the affected area. This includes using high-velocity fans, dehumidifiers, and other specialized equipment to remove moisture from the air and spe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

After the drying process is complete,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old and mildew growth. This includes using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ining moisture and contaminants.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Report

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the job is done to your satisfaction. We’ll also provide a detailed report outlining the work that was done, including before and after photos.

Warning Signs You Need Apartment Water Extraction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s that you need Apartment Water Ext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ty or mildewy odor in your apartment that won’t go away, it could be a sign of water damage. This is especially true if you’ve recently experienced a leak or flood.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ty odor or discoloration.

Discolored Walls or Ceilings

Discolored wal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ty odor or peeling paint.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of water damage, especially if they’re accompanied by a musty odor or discoloration.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ty odor or discoloration.

Visible Signs of Leaks or Water Damage

Visible signs of leaks or water damage, such as water pooling or dripping from ceilings or walls, can be a sign that you need Apartment Water Extraction.

Apartment Water Extraction Cost In Thomasville, NC

The cost of Apartment Water Extraction in Thomasville, NC can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Apartment Water Ext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Dehumidification and Ventilation $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Repairs and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Hidden Water Damage Detection $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Emergency Response and Mitigation $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ific circumstances of your water damage.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an to fit your budget and needs.
